1) Solution 1: Using Your Google Account To Unlock Your Phone

If you’ve forgotten your PIN, one of the easiest ways to unlock your phone is by using your Google Account. Here’s how to do it:

1. Enter the wrong PIN multiple times until you see the “Forgot PIN” or “Forgot Pattern” option on your screen.
2. Tap on the option, and you’ll be prompted to enter your Google Account credentials.
3. Enter the email address and password associated with your Google Account.
4. Follow the on-screen instructions to verify your identity.
5. Once verified, you’ll be able to create a new PIN and gain access to your phone again.

Keep in mind that this method will only work if you have an active internet connection on your device and if you have previously set up your Google Account on your phone. If you don’t have internet access or haven’t linked your Google Account, you may need to use one of the other solutions mentioned in this article.

Solution 3: Using Android Device Manager To Unlock Your Phone Remotely

If you have forgotten your PIN and your phone is connected to the internet, one convenient method to unlock your phone remotely is by using Android Device Manager. This solution works if you have previously enabled the “Find My Device” feature on your phone. Here’s how you can do it:

1. On a computer or another smartphone, open a web browser and visit the Android Device Manager website.
2. Sign in using the Google account associated with your locked phone.
3. Once logged in, you will see a map displaying the location of your phone. Use the options on the left-hand side of the screen to access the “Lock” option.
4. Enter a new temporary password and press the “Lock” button.
5. Within a few seconds, your phone will receive the new password and unlock itself.
6. Now, you can access your phone using the temporary password you just set.
7. Finally, go to the phone’s settings and disable the temporary password option. Set a new PIN that you will remember.

Using Android Device Manager to remotely unlock your phone can be a lifesaver if you forget your PIN. Just make sure to enable the feature on your phone beforehand to utilize this solution effectively.

Solution 4: Unlocking Your Phone Using Samsung Find My Mobile

Samsung Find My Mobile is a feature specifically designed for Samsung devices that can help you unlock your phone if you forget your PIN. This solution is exclusively available for Samsung users and requires pre-activation of the Find My Mobile feature on your device.

To unlock your phone using Samsung Find My Mobile, you need to have a Samsung account linked to your device. Visit the Find My Mobile website on a computer or another device and sign in with your Samsung account credentials. Once you’re logged in, locate your device on the website and select the “Unlock my device” option. Follow the instructions provided, and your device will be unlocked, allowing you to access it without the PIN.

Not only does Samsung Find My Mobile allow you to unlock your phone, but it also offers several other features such as remotely locking your device, tracking its location, and even erasing data in case of theft or loss.

Remember, this solution is only applicable to Samsung devices and requires prior activation of the Find My Mobile feature. If you are a Samsung user, it is highly recommended to activate this feature to ensure easy access to your phone if you forget your PIN.

Solution 6: Factory Resetting Your Phone As The Last Resort

If all else fails and you still can’t remember your PIN, factory resetting your phone is the last resort. This solution will erase all data and settings on your device, restoring it to its factory defaults. While this will unlock your phone, it is important to note that you will lose all your data, including contacts, photos, and apps. Therefore, it is recommended to regularly backup your phone’s data to prevent losing important information.

To factory reset your phone, follow these steps:
1. Power off your device.
2. Press and hold the volume up button, the power button, and the home button (if applicable) simultaneously until the phone vibrates and the recovery menu appears.
3. Using the volume buttons, navigate to the “Factory Reset” or “Wipe Data/Factory Reset” option and select it using the power button.
4. Confirm the action by selecting “Yes” or “Delete All/User Data,” depending on your device.
5. Wait for the process to complete, and then select the “Reboot System Now” option to restart your phone.

After the factory reset, you can set up your phone as a new device and create a new PIN. Remember to create a PIN that is easy for you to remember but not easily guessable by others to avoid facing a similar situation in the future.

Tips To Avoid Future PIN Forgetfulness And Ensure Easy Access To Your Phone

Forgetting your phone PIN can be frustrating and can cause a lot of inconvenience. To avoid future PIN forgetfulness and ensure easy access to your phone, consider following these tips:

1. Use a memorable PIN: Choose a PIN that is easy for you to remember but difficult for others to guess. Avoid using common numbers like birthdates or sequential patterns.

2. Set up fingerprint or face recognition: Most modern smartphones allow you to unlock your device using your fingerprint or facial recognition. Set up these methods as an alternative to your PIN for convenience.

3. Enable smart lock features: Utilize smart lock features such as trusted locations, trusted devices, or voice recognition. These features automatically unlock your phone when certain criteria are met, such as being in a trusted Wi-Fi network or connected to a trusted Bluetooth device.

4. Regularly backup your data: Backup your important files, photos, and contacts regularly. If you ever need to factory reset your phone, you can restore your data and settings without losing important information.

5. Keep a backup PIN or pattern: In case you forget your main PIN, have a backup option set up. This way, you can easily switch to the backup option without losing access to your device.

6. Use a password manager: Consider using a password manager application to securely store and manage your PINs. These apps can generate strong, unique PINs for you and remember them on your behalf.

By implementing these tips, you can prevent future PIN forgetfulness and ensure easy access to your phone. Remember, prevention is always better than finding yourself locked out of your device.
